64 Sovereign St, Iluka is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 2005. The property has a land size of 966m2 and floor size of 273m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in January 2025.

The size of Iluka is approximately 12.8 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 51.3% of total area. The population of Iluka in 2016 was 1718 people. By 2021 the population was 1764 showing a population growth of 2.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Iluka is 60-69 years. Households in Iluka are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Iluka work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 65.40% of the homes in Iluka were owner-occupied compared with 65.50% in 2016.
